软件开发使用的工具有哪些?💻哪些工具能让编程小白变大神?🔥-软件开发-EDUC教育网
教育
教育网
学习留学移民英语学校教育
联系我们SITEMAP
教育学习软件开发

软件开发使用的工具有哪些?💻哪些工具能让编程小白变大神?🔥

2025-10-17 15:20:47 发布

软件开发使用的工具有哪些?💻哪些工具能让编程小白变大神?🔥,盘点软件开发常用工具,涵盖代码编辑器、调试工具、版本控制等,帮助编程爱好者提升效率,轻松入门开发领域。

一、代码编辑器:程序员的第一块画布🎨

提到软件开发,首先得聊聊代码编辑器。对于编程新手来说,选择一款合适的代码编辑器至关重要,它就像是你的第一块画布,承载着所有创意的起点。
Visual Studio Code(简称VS Code)就是很多开发者的首选工具之一,它界面简洁、功能强大,而且支持多种编程语言,安装各种插件后简直如虎添翼!比如安装Python扩展包后,可以直接在编辑器里运行Python脚本,非常方便。
Sublime Text 则以轻量级著称,操作流畅,尤其适合处理小型项目。如果你觉得收费有些贵,也可以试试免费开源的 Atom,它是GitHub推出的编辑器,社区活跃,插件丰富。

小提示:代码编辑器不仅能帮你快速编写代码,还能自动补全代码,减少错误,提高效率。所以,选对工具,事半功倍哦!🌟

二、调试工具:排查错误的好帮手🔍

代码写完后,难免会出现各种Bug,这时候就需要调试工具来帮忙了。调试工具就像是医生手中的听诊器,能精准定位问题所在。
Chrome DevTools 是前端开发者的好伙伴,它可以帮助你实时查看网页元素、调试JavaScript代码、检查网络请求等。比如当你遇到页面加载慢的问题时,可以使用它的性能面板,找出瓶颈所在。
而对于后端开发者来说,Postman 是必备神器。它可以用来测试API接口,发送HTTP请求,查看响应数据,简直就是接口调试的利器!

记住,调试工具不仅仅是解决问题的手段,更是提升开发技能的重要途径。学会善用它们,会让你的开发之路更加顺畅。🚀

三、版本控制工具:团队协作的桥梁🔗

软件开发往往不是一个人的战斗,团队合作是常态。这时,版本控制工具就显得尤为重要了。它就像是团队之间的沟通桥梁,确保每个人都能同步最新的代码。
Git 是目前最流行的版本控制系统,几乎所有开发者都会用到它。通过Git,你可以轻松管理代码的版本,随时回溯历史记录,避免因为误操作导致的数据丢失。
GitHubGitLab 则是基于Git的在线托管平台,提供了强大的代码托管服务,还支持Issue追踪、Pull Request等功能,非常适合团队协作开发。

团队合作时,合理利用版本控制工具不仅能提高工作效率,还能减少不必要的冲突。所以,尽早掌握Git的基本操作,会让你在团队中脱颖而出哦!✨

四、集成开发环境(IDE):一站式解决方案💻

对于一些复杂的项目,仅仅依靠代码编辑器可能不够,这时就需要集成开发环境(IDE)登场了。IDE就像是一个超级工具箱,集成了代码编辑、调试、构建、测试等多种功能。
例如 Eclipse 是Java开发者的最爱,它内置了强大的插件生态系统,支持各种框架和工具的集成。而 IntelliJ IDEA 则以其智能提示和代码优化功能闻名,特别适合大型Java项目的开发。
对于Python开发者来说,PyCharm 是不可错过的选择,它专门为Python量身打造,提供了丰富的代码分析和调试工具。

IDE的强大之处在于它能够将开发流程中的各个环节无缝整合在一起,让你专注于核心业务逻辑,而不是被琐碎的事情分散注意力。所以,找到适合自己语言的IDE,会让你的开发体验更上一层楼!💫

五、其他辅助工具:锦上添花的小确幸🌟

除了上述主要工具外,还有一些辅助工具可以帮助你更好地完成开发工作。
比如 NotionTrello 这样的项目管理工具,可以用来规划任务、跟踪进度,非常适合团队协作。而 Markdown 编辑器则可以帮助你轻松撰写文档,格式整洁且易于阅读。
另外,Docker 是近年来非常火的容器化技术,它可以让你的应用程序在不同的环境中保持一致的行为,极大地方便了部署和测试。

这些辅助工具虽然不是必不可少的,但它们的存在无疑会让你的开发工作更加高效和愉快。所以,不妨尝试一下,说不定会有意想不到的收获呢!🎉

六、总结:工具虽好,但人更重要的人才是关键💪

软件开发工具虽然重要,但归根结底,人是最重要的因素。无论使用多么先进的工具,最终还是要靠开发者自身的创造力和技术能力来实现目标。
所以,不要一味追求工具的数量和种类,而是要学会如何有效地使用它们。同时,也要不断学习新的技术和工具,跟上时代的步伐。

最后,记住一句话:工具只是手段,真正的核心是你的思维和实践。愿每一位开发者都能用好手中的工具,创造出令人惊叹的作品!💫


TAG:教育 | 软件开发 | 软件开发 | 工具推荐 | 编程小白 | 代码编辑器 | 项目管理
文章链接:https://www.9educ.com/ruanjiankaifa/209980.html
提示:本信息均源自互联网,只能做为信息参考,并不能作为任何依据,准确性和时效性需要读者进一步核实,请不要下载与分享,本站也不为此信息做任何负责,内容或者图片如有误请及时联系本站,我们将在第一时间做出修改或者删除
云端编程新纪元!企业如何轻松购入企云云软
在这个数字化转型的时代,企业们都渴望提升软件开发效率。企云云作为新兴的开发平台,如何让您的IT之
软件开发平台简介?💻那些适合新手的编程神
详解主流软件开发平台的特点与功能,推荐适合编程小白的开发工具,手把手教你快速上手编程世界。
最新软件开发工具有哪些?💻哪些能提升编程
盘点最新软件开发工具,涵盖代码编辑、项目管理、测试调试等多个领域,帮助开发者提升效率,优化工作流
谁是软件开发界的超级英雄?揭秘2022年
在数字化世界里,谁能称得上是软件开发领域的超级大国?让我们一起揭晓这份2022年最具影响力的企业
教育本站内容和图片均来自互联网,仅供读者参考,请勿转载与分享,如有内容和图片有误或者涉及侵权请及时联系本站处理。
Encyclopediaknowledge
菜谱食谱美食穿搭文化sneaker球鞋街头奢侈品时尚百科养生健康彩妆美妆化妆品美容问答国外海外攻略古迹名胜景区景点旅行旅游学校大学英语移民留学学习教育篮球足球主播导演明星动漫综艺电视剧电影影视科技潮牌品牌生活家电健身旅游数码美丽体育汽车游戏娱乐潮流网红热榜知识